display process

Use display process to display process state information.
Syntax
display process [ all | job job-id | name process-name ] [ slot slot-number ]
Views
Any view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
network-operator
Parameters
all: Specifies all processes. With the all keyword or without any parameters, the command displays state
information for all processes.
job job-id: Specifies a process by its job ID, in the range of 1 to 2147483647. Each process has a fixed
job ID.
name process-name: Specifies a process by its name, a case-insensitive string of 1 to 15 characters that
must not contain question marks or spaces.
slot slot-number: Specifies an IRF member device by its ID. Without this option, the command displays
process state information for the master device.
